The former NBA player accused of attempted robbery had his jury trial rescheduled for February last week.

Donte Greene was arrested on charges of robbery, intimidation and interfering in the reporting of a crime after police were dispatched to Phillips 66 in Goshen in November.

The Goshen News reports that a clerk at the gas station told officers that Greene had told him to “give him all the money” before making threatening motions.

Surveillance footage confirms Greene talking with the clerk, walking around the store, taking items out of his pocket and taking his shirt off before reportedly lunging at the cashier.

His jury trial has been rescheduled from September to February.
